LaTeX в PNG

Перетворюйте LaTeX у PNG за допомогою API Рішення для Java

Як конвертувати LaTeX у PNG за допомогою Java

Aspose.TeX АПІ Конвертер LaTeX у PNG перетворює файл LaTeX у PNG за допомогою мови програмування Java.

Представлений тут API можна використовувати для створення власної кросплатформної програми або інтегрувати її у ваш проєкт Java.

Щоб перетворити LaTeX у PNG:

  • Використайте Aspose.TeX для Java API, який є багатофункціональним, потужним і простим у використанні API для обробки та перетворення документів для платформи Java.
  • Ви можете завантажити його останню версію безпосередньо з Aspose Maven Repository і інсталювати його у своєму проєкті на основі Maven, додавши такі конфігурації до pom.xml:

Repository

<repository>
    <id>snapshots</id>
    <name>repo</name>
    <url>http://repository.aspose.com/repo/</url>
</repository>

Dependency

<dependency>
    <groupId>com.aspose</groupId>
    <artifactId>aspose-tex</artifactId>
    <version>21.4</version>
</dependency>

Етапи конвертації LaTeX у PNG у Java

Aspose.TeX полегшує розробникам перетворення файлів LaTeX у PNG лише за допомогою кількох рядків коду.

  1. Створіть об’єкт класу TeXOptions .
  2. Щоб встановити простір або область, куди буде записаний вивід TeX, встановіть робочий каталог файлової системи для виведення за допомогою OutputWorkingDirectory .
  3. Ініціалізуйте параметри збереження для формату PNG за допомогою класу PngSaveOptions .
  4. Створіть об’єкт класу TeXJob і запустіть перетворення LaTeX у PNG за допомогою методу run() .

Системні вимоги

Aspose.TeX для Java підтримується всіма основними операційними системами. Просто переконайтеся, що у ваше середовище відповідає наступним вимогам:

  • J2SE 8.0 (1.8) або вище.
Приклад коду Java: перетворення LaTeX у зображення, XPS, PDF або SVG
Input file
Upload a file you want to convert
Output format
Select the target format
                
// Create conversion options for Object LaTeX format on Object TeX engine extension.
TeXOptions options = TeXOptions.consoleAppOptions(TeXConfig.objectLaTeX());
// Specify the file system working directory for the output.
options.setOutputWorkingDirectory(new OutputFileSystemDirectory(Utils.getOutputDirectory()));
// Initialize the options for saving in PNG format.
options.setSaveOptions(new PngSaveOptions());

// Run LaTeX to PNG conversion.
new TeXJob(Utils.getInputDirectory() + "hello-world.tex", new ImageDevice(), options).run();

            

LaTeX What is LaTeX File Format

LaTeX — це формат TeX, якщо коротко. Файли LaTeX — це звичайні текстові файли, написані власною мовою розмітки. Вони можуть вимагати включення інших даних, таких як зображення та/або інші файли LaTeX. LaTeX надає вам багато розширених функцій для створення таблиць, додавання графіки, написання математичних рівнянь і формул тощо. Усі ці функції доступні в так званих пакетах.

PNG What is PNG File Format

Portable Network Graphics або PNG є одним із найпопулярніших форматів зображень. Він забезпечує дійсно хороше стиснення, зберігаючи високу якість зображення. PNG також є одним із найкращих форматів для веб-проєктів, оскільки файли легші, а зображення легко масштабувати. Одним із недоліків формату при використанні в Інтернеті є те, що неможливо додати ключові слова безпосередньо до зображення.